Validate local files, in steam by going to properties of the game and "local files".Ī lot f times, weird issues are often fixed by going to the game executable in file explorer, right clicking, and the "compatibility" tab turn off "High DPI Scaling"Īlso, within the games graphics settings, turn off HBAO from the ambient occlusion setting. Shut down all processes that may be hooking into video, like riva tnt server, game overalys (except uplay of course), turn off game capture things like NVidia shadow play, steam stream server, etc. Then re-install the drivers using the latest. Use the best mode which requires boot into safe mode - that is the best way to ensure all pieces are removed. Use Display Driver Uninstaller (DDU) to remove the GPU driver completely.
